Measurement of the Pressure induced by salt crystallization in confinement [PDF]

open access: yesarXiv, 2016
Salt crystallization is a major cause of weathering of artworks, monuments and rocks. Damage will occur if crystals continue to grow in confinement, i.e. within the pore space of these materials generating mechanical stresses. Two-phase pore-network model for evaporation-driven salt precipitation -- representation and analysis of pore-scale processes [PDF]

open access: yesarXiv
Evaporation-driven salt precipitation occurs in different contexts and leads to challenges in case of e.g. soil salinization or stress-introducing precipitation in building material. During evaporation, brine in porous media gets concentrated due to the loss of water until the solubility limit is reached and salt precipitates.
